Agiculture, health at risk from declining diurnal temperature range
Variation in diurnal temperature range is asymmetric over India's four agroclimatic zones with a marked accelerating decrease in the range witnessed over the last 30 years in the northwest, parts of Gangetic plains, northeast, and central ...
